1. Particular muscle relaxer
The chance of a muscle relaxant showing on a drug take a look at is immediately contingent upon the particular muscle relaxer ingested. Completely different substances have distinct chemical buildings and metabolic pathways, resulting in variations of their detectability. For instance, carisoprodol (Soma) is metabolized into meprobamate, a Schedule IV managed substance with an extended half-life, which will be particularly screened for. Conversely, cyclobenzaprine (Flexeril) just isn’t at all times included in customary drug panels however could also be detected if the take a look at is particularly designed to establish it. The composition of the ingested substance immediately causes variations in how these substances are metabolized.
The kind of drug take a look at employed additional dictates whether or not a selected muscle relaxant is detected. Customary immunoassay screenings typically goal broad courses of medication, and will not be delicate sufficient to detect sure muscle relaxants or their metabolites. Extra particular and delicate assessments, akin to gasoline chromatography-mass spectrometry (GC-MS) or liquid chromatography-mass spectrometry (LC-MS), are able to figuring out a wider array of gear, together with particular muscle relaxants. Subsequently, the selection of take a look at methodology will drastically have an effect on the detectability of a selected relaxant.
In abstract, the correlation between the particular muscle relaxant and its detection on a drug take a look at hinges on the chemical properties of the drug, the metabolic pathway it undergoes, and the sensitivity of the drug screening methodology utilized. Understanding these components is essential for figuring out the potential for a optimistic drug take a look at outcome. 3. Metabolite detection window
The metabolite detection window is a important think about figuring out whether or not muscle relaxers will likely be detected on a drug take a look at. This window refers back to the interval throughout which a drug or its metabolites stay detectable within the physique’s techniques, akin to urine, blood, or saliva. The period of this window is influenced by numerous elements, together with the particular drug, dosage, frequency of use, particular person metabolism, and the kind of drug take a look at used.
-
Half-Life and Detection Period
The half-life of a muscle relaxant and its metabolites immediately impacts the detection window. Medicine with shorter half-lives are metabolized and eradicated from the physique extra rapidly, leading to a shorter detection window. Conversely, medication with longer half-lives stay detectable for prolonged durations. For instance, carisoprodol (Soma), which is metabolized into meprobamate, has an extended detection window because of meprobamate’s longer half-life. This prolonged presence will increase the chance of detection on a drug take a look at in comparison with muscle relaxants with shorter half-lives. Testing Medium and Detection Thresholds
The kind of testing medium used (urine, blood, saliva, hair) additionally impacts the metabolite detection window. Urine assessments are most typical and customarily have detection home windows starting from a couple of days to every week for many muscle relaxants. Blood assessments usually have shorter detection home windows, typically restricted to some days. Saliva assessments supply a good shorter detection window, normally spanning a couple of hours to a few days. Hair follicle assessments, whereas much less widespread for muscle relaxants, can present an extended detection window, doubtlessly spanning a number of weeks or months. The chosen medium and the detection thresholds set by the testing laboratory collectively decide the period for which metabolites will be recognized. 8. Medical overview officer roles
The position of a Medical Assessment Officer (MRO) is essential in figuring out the implications when muscle relaxers are detected on a drug take a look at. The MRO serves as an impartial and neutral gatekeeper, making certain the accuracy and equity of the drug testing course of. This skilled’s duties lengthen past merely reporting optimistic outcomes, encompassing a complete overview of medical historical past and prescription data to determine the legitimacy of drug use.
-
Verification of Prescriptions
A major perform of the MRO is to confirm whether or not a person has a sound prescription for the detected muscle relaxer. This includes contacting the prescribing doctor to substantiate the prescription’s authenticity, dosage, and medical necessity. If a sound prescription exists, the MRO experiences the take a look at as unfavourable, despite the fact that the substance was current. This course of prevents unwarranted disciplinary motion towards people utilizing prescribed medicines legitimately. With out the MRO’s verification, a optimistic take a look at for a muscle relaxer, regardless of a sound prescription, might lead to undue penalties.
